One customer journey.

Clear ownership at every step.

A customer can start with Nia, move into Remy’s follow-up, gain extra context from Research, and reach you only when judgement is actually needed. Supervision watches what that movement is becoming without taking ownership away from the people doing the work.

01 · Front Desk

Nia is there when the customer arrives.

She can answer the first question, understand what the customer needs, and leave the conversation with a real next step—even when you are somewhere else.

02 · Chat

When the work changes hands, the customer story does not.

Nia may start the conversation. Remy may own what happens next. The reply, what has already happened, and the next step stay together.

03 · Pipeline

Remy keeps the follow-through visible.

Replies, waiting periods, due dates, and future follow-up stay organized around what actually needs to happen next instead of becoming another list to remember.

04 · Research

Research stays behind the scenes until it is useful.

Hermes can gather business context, website findings, likely contacts, and the evidence behind them before Remy—or you—spends time deciding what deserves the next move.

05 · Supervision

Supervision watches the pattern before it becomes your problem.

Aletheia looks across ownership, evidence, policy, patterns, and outcomes for the moments that should not quietly continue on autopilot. She does not replace your judgement; she makes better use of it.

06 · Command Centre

Know what moved without watching every step.

See what Nia handled, what Remy is moving, what Research found, what Supervision surfaced, and the small number of moments that still need your judgement.
